Java Eclipse类型层次结构窗口中图标的含义

Java Eclipse类型层次结构窗口中图标的含义,java,eclipse,Java,Eclipse,在Eclipse中,Java方法覆盖指示器是类型层次结构视图中方法旁边的小向上箭头 实心箭头表示方法覆盖层次结构中较低的现有方法 空心箭头是什么意思 注释会影响arrow吗?在我看来,arrow的“空心”或白色表示该方法不会重写超类方法,而是实现在接口中指定的方法 注释不应该与此相关。在java/editor/save actions部分中只有一个首选项设置,用于定义是否自动插入覆盖注释,但它仅在语义上,但在技术上与所提到的箭头无关,我认为是“空心”或白色,箭头表示此方法不重写超类方法,而是实现

在Eclipse中,Java方法覆盖指示器是类型层次结构视图中方法旁边的小向上箭头

实心箭头表示方法覆盖层次结构中较低的现有方法

空心箭头是什么意思

注释会影响arrow吗?

在我看来,arrow的“空心”或白色表示该方法不会重写超类方法,而是实现在接口中指定的方法

注释不应该与此相关。在
java/editor/save actions
部分中只有一个首选项设置,用于定义是否自动插入覆盖注释,但它仅在语义上,但在技术上与所提到的箭头无关,我认为是“空心”或白色,箭头表示此方法不重写超类方法,而是实现在接口中指定的方法


注释不应该与此相关。
java/editor/save actions
部分中只有一个首选项设置,用于定义是否自动插入覆盖注释,但它仅在语义上,而在技术上与所提到的箭头无关

!非常感谢。现在假设类A扩展类B,类A实现接口1,接口1扩展接口2,类B实现接口2。进一步假设在所有4个位置都声明了一个方法foo。类视图应该显示为extends(实心)还是implements(空心)?extends“比”implements更重要,所以它是绿色的。(刚刚试过,eclipse似乎同意我的观点:-)确实如此!非常感谢。现在假设类A扩展类B,类A实现接口1,接口1扩展接口2,类B实现接口2。进一步假设在所有4个位置都声明了一个方法foo。类视图应该显示为extends(实心)还是implements(空心)?extends“比”implements更重要,所以它是绿色的。(刚刚尝试过,eclipse似乎同意我的观点:-)